I used Scratch X on my previous car to get rid of some fine scratches on my spoiler, and it looked great after it was done.
A year later the place where I applied Scratch X looked terrible, like it had been sandpapered. My dark blue car looked like it was being viewed through scratched glass. Adding more wax reduced the problem, but it required too much maintenance. Never again will I use that product. I'll take it to a pro if I ever get into that same situation.
